What Is Family Law?

Family law is a broad legal practice area that governs family relationships, including marriage, divorce, child custody, and financial obligations. It addresses both personal and financial issues that arise within families and aims to ensure fairness and the well-being of all parties involved.
Family law cases are typically handled in civil courts, where judges make decisions based on state laws, legal precedents, and the best interests of any children involved. Since family law varies by state, it's crucial to consult a family lawyer near you who understands the local legal landscape.

Key Areas of Family Law

Family law encompasses several key areas, including:

1. Marriage and Prenuptial Agreements

Marriage is a legal contract that comes with rights and responsibilities for both partners. Family law regulates marriage licenses, property rights, and spousal responsibilities.
Prenuptial agreements (or “prenups”) are legal contracts signed before marriage that outline how assets, debts, and financial matters will be handled in the event of divorce or death. These agreements can protect individuals from financial disputes and ensure clarity in asset division.
One of the most common aspects of family law is divorce. A divorce legally dissolves a marriage, determining matters such as:
  • Division of assets and debts
  • Spousal support (alimony)
  • Child custody and visitation
  • Child support
Divorces can be contested (when spouses disagree on terms) or uncontested (when both parties agree). Some states also offer legal separation, which allows couples to live apart and settle financial matters without officially divorcing.

3. Child Custody and Visitation

When parents separate, determining child custody and visitation becomes a major legal concern. Courts focus on the best interests of the child when deciding custody arrangements.
Common custody arrangements include:
  • Physical custody: Determines where the child will live.
  • Legal custody: Determines who makes major decisions about the child’s upbringing (education, healthcare, religion, etc.).
  • Joint custody: Both parents share custody responsibilities.
  • Sole custody: One parent has full legal and/or physical custody.

4. Child Support

Child support is a financial obligation that ensures children receive the necessary care and resources following a separation or divorce. Family courts use various factors to determine child support payments, including:
  • The income of both parents
  • The child's financial needs
  • The custody arrangement
Failure to pay child support can lead to wage garnishment, license suspension, and other legal consequences. If you need assistance with child support modifications, consult a family lawyer near you for guidance.

5. Adoption and Guardianship

Adoption legally establishes a parent-child relationship between individuals who are not biologically related. Family law governs different types of adoption, including:
  • Domestic adoption (within the U.S.)
  • International adoption
  • Stepparent adoption
  • Foster care adoption
Guardianship is another legal process where an individual is granted custody of a minor or incapacitated adult, typically when the biological parents are unable to care for them.

6. Domestic Violence and Protective Orders

Family law also addresses domestic violence cases, ensuring the safety of victims through protective orders (restraining orders) and legal interventions. Courts can issue orders that prevent abusers from contacting victims or coming near their home or workplace.

7. Paternity and Parental Rights

Paternity law establishes the legal father of a child, which affects custody, visitation, and child support rights. In some cases, DNA testing may be required to confirm paternity.
Once paternity is established, courts can determine parental rights, including visitation schedules and child support obligations.
